Default Sagging structure?

The building is actually structurally sound despite 14 years of neglect. He tried to make it less attractive by removing all the windows and leaving it open.
The city tried to salvage the wonderful woodwork and fireplaces and a few other stuff, but Cafua management been stalling the process up to this day. Probably because he is upset with the boycotting of his store every weekend.
The building has an interesting history. It was originally built to be the Governor's Mansion, thus the elaborate architecture.
